Haiti - News : Zapping... 21/02/2020 10:51:06 Pierre Yves Lesaye, the spokesperson for the National Police of Haiti (PNH) in the South, revealed this week that from January 13 to February 15, 2020 the South Departmental Directorate of the PNH had arrested 168 people (108 flagrant crimes and 60 with warrant). Arrest of kidnapper "Mafia" The dangerous bandit John Rémy aka "Mafia" actively wanted for kidnapping, was arrested Wednesday in the Commune of Croix-des-Bouquets, by agents of the Central Direction of the Judicial Police (DCPJ). He was in possession of a 9mm pistol, 138 cartridges and 5 magazines which the police seized. D-3, The Port-au-Prince Carnival will take place Thursday Guy François Junior, the President of the National Carnival Committee, Guy François Junior, confirmed that the Carnival was maintened in Port-au-Prince and that the parade would take place at the Champ-de-Mars. In addition, within the framework of regional carnivals he indicated that about twenty musical groups were selected which will be distributed in 5 cities, among others : Cap-Haitien, Les Cayes and St-Marc and affirmed that security will be ensured everywhere "The national police and the Superior Council of the National Police (CSPN) have a responsibility to protect and serve and to provide security. The OPC condemns without reserve The Office for the Protection of the Citizen (OPC), condemns without reserve the acts of vandalism recorded in the premises of the Cabinet of Me Samuel Madistin in the afternoon of February 19 https://www.icihaiti.com/en/news-30070-icihaiti-demonstration-the-cabinet-of-me-madistin-attacked-and-vandalized.html "These acts of violence exerted against the premises of the cabinet of Me Madistin (President of the Foundation Je Klere) and of other scenes of vandalism recorded in the capital constitute an act of intolerance and barbarism endangering many democratic achievements guaranteed by the Haitian constitution [...]" COVID-19 epidemic : February 21 global report Friday, February 21, 2020, the number of people infected worldwide with the Coronavirus COVID-19 (laboratory confirmed cases) amounted to 76,727, an increase of 1,000 cases (+ 1.3%) compared to the previous day https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-30076-haiti-news-zapping.html ; 2,247 deaths (+ 5.5%) or 118 more than the day before (2,129); 18,562 people healed, that is 2,036 people (+ 12.3%) more than the day before but 8.2 times more healing than death compared to 7.7 times the day before. To date, there have been 1,260 infected people confirmed outside of China (+ 24%), ie 245 more cases. 9 deaths abroad since the start of the epidemic (in December 2019), i.e. 4 more than the previous day : 2 in Iran, 1 in South Korea, 1 in Taiwan, 1 in the Philippines, 2 in Hong Kong , 1 in Japan and 1 in France.
